Tianjin Economic-technological Development Area (TEDA)(天津经济技术开发区)
Tianjin Economic-technological Development Area |
Established in December 1984, the Tianjin Economic-technological Development Area (TEDA) was one of the earliest national-level development zones in the country.
Through 27 years of development, TEDA has fostered nine leading industries: information technology; automobile and machinery manufacturing; bio-medicine; food and beverages; new materials, new energy and environmental protection; equipment manufacturing; petrochemical; aviation and modern services.
By the end of 2010, TEDA had approved foreign investments by 4,870 enterprises from 74 countries and regions, including world-famous companies such as Motorola, Samsung, Panasonic, Toyota, Coca-Cola and Kyocera, with a combined value of US$62.21 billion. Its gross industrial output reached 510.13 billion yuan (US$79.85 billion) last year. A total of 78 Fortune Global 500 enterprises have invested in 166 projects in the area.
